Stronger-Than-Expected January Jobs Report Reinforces View That Fed Will Pause
U.S. nonfarm payrolls increased by 130,000 in January and the unemployment rate edged down to 4.3% from 4.4% in December, surpassing economists' median forecast of a 70,000 gain.
